Using bullet points, numbering, or color coding to break up content is a good strategy for:

  1. Notetaking

    • Helps organize information clearly.
    • Makes it easier to review and find key points.
  2. Email

    • Enhances readability of messages.
    • Allows for quick scanning of important details.
  3. Time Management

    • Assists in prioritizing tasks effectively.
    • Breaks down projects into manageable steps.
  4. Live Lessons

    • Keeps students engaged with structured content.
    • Aids in emphasizing important topics during presentations.
